Major Responsibilities
Build and deliver reports, models and data analysis
Develop and maintain reporting systems and visualization toolsets to illustrate monthly trends, outliers, variances
Develop and maintain statistical algorithms and systems to proactively monitor financial performance
Articulate analytical findings and share insights
Advance the program by incorporating complementary systems, such as Connected Fleet
Pull and analyze data for Ad-Hoc requests
Other projects as assigned by the Manager
Qualifications
At least 3 years data analytics experience required
At least 3 years of business or operational experience preferred
Bachelors in Engineering, Mathematics, Statistics, or Data Science/Analytics preferred
Strong analytical skills required
Independent problem solving skills required
Strong oral and written communication skills required
Advanced use of Microsoft Excel and Access required
Proficiency in the use of Microsoft Outlook, Word, and PowerPoint required
Proficiency in writing complex SQL queries required
Strong understanding of AWS data analytics tools, including Athena and QuickSight, preferred
Visual Basic programming preferred
Process mapping experience preferred
Data mining and report tool (experience Qlikview, Green Plum, Business Objects, etc.) plus
Quality program certification (Six Sigma, ISO, LEAN, etc.) plus
